Context
In this hadith narrated by 'Abdur-Rahman bin Samurah, 'Uthman presented a large sum of money to the Prophet Muhammad (ﷺ) for a charitable cause. The Prophet (ﷺ) praised 'Uthman's generosity, indicating that his good deeds would not be forgotten. This highlights the importance of charitable actions in Islam.
Modern Application
This hadith serves as an encouragement for Muslims to engage in charitable acts and to contribute to the welfare of others. It reminds believers that their good deeds are recognized and rewarded by Allah.
